In the spirit of collaboration within the security community, the Dell SecureWorks Counter Threat Unit (CTU) Security Research Team invites you to participate in a private Threat Intelligence Summit at the historic Hotel Monaco in Washington D.C. on November 10-11.

The objective of the Threat Intelligence Summit is to advance participants’ collective knowledge and foster professional connections in this private, invitation-only forum. There is no registration fee to attend, and all meals will be covered by Dell SecureWorks.

This is a collaborative forum. There will be a block of time reserved at the beginning of the agenda for the attendees to break into groups for a collaborative session focused on creating questions specifically to be answered by a panel of CTU researchers – a group that will come together specifically for this event.
